Output 43ba46d708bb2969208c9d11f76e25eca65b0d4026e5ca2ebde7a3283324f947:12

value
1536072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ab657ffbbaf2e487eeeb1e89255670b6865dd25 OP_EQUAL
address
3Fo4RYvYYeESKodeBAcfdYq8od5wmeq4Tv
transaction
43ba46d708bb2969208c9d11f76e25eca65b0d4026e5ca2ebde7a3283324f947
spent
true